COPD 缓解期患者阈压力负荷吸气肌锻炼的疗效观察 被引量:8

Effects of threshold loading device for inspiratory muscles training in patients with COPD

摘要 作者自行研制一种阈压力负荷吸气肌锻炼器,该锻炼器通过弹簧控制吸气瓣开瓣压,压力负荷与弹簧压缩程度成直线关系,故调节方便且基本不受吸气流量的影响。34例COPD缓解期患者用40%最大口腔吸气压(maxiuminspiratorypresure,MIP)作为压力负荷,每天用该锻炼器锻炼40min,5周后MIP由637±217kPa(479±163mmHg)增加到779±242kPa(586±182mmHg),P<001,负荷呼吸时间由1724±903s延长到2679±1575s(P<001),常规肺功能指标则无明显变化。25例对照组上述指标均无明显变化。锻炼组中8例继续锻炼10周,MIP和负荷呼吸时间较锻炼5周时进一步提高;用力肺活量、第一秒用力呼气量和最大通气量也较锻炼前增加。另外8例停止锻炼10周后各项参数均返回到锻炼前水平。 The physical characters and clinical significance of a threshold loading device for inspiratory muscle training in patients with COPD was reported. The loading was adjustable easily and linearly by the spring which controlled the motion of the inspiratory valve. The loading was so stable that it was hardly affected by flow rate. 34 COPD patients (treatment group) were trained 40min per day for 5 weeks with the device loaded with 40% MIP. The beneficials were as following: (1) MIP raised from 6 37±2 17kPa(47 9±16 3mmHg) to 7 79±2 42kPa(58.6±18.2mmHg) ( P <0 01).(2)The time of loading breathing prolonged from 172.4±90.3s to 267.9±157.5s, P <0 01. There was no change in routine pulmonary function. Oppositely, there was no any change in the control group (25 cases). In the treatment group, 8 cases were trained for additional course of 10 weeks, and the further improvement could be found in MIP and the time of loading breathing. Furthermore, FVC, FEV 1 and MVV also increased significantly. All the beneficials disappeared when other 8 cases discontinued the training for 10 weeks.
